Pricing and Itinerary
With a price of £125 per person, the Invergordon Cruise Excursion to Dunrobin Castle and Dornoch offers an enchanting itinerary that showcases the beauty and history of the Scottish Highlands.
Travelers will be captivated by the stunning landscapes and charming villages they’ll visit.
The tour includes a visit to Beauly Priory, a Medieval monastery, where visitors can enjoy the history of the area.
They’ll also have the opportunity to explore Dornoch Cathedral and learn about whisky production at a distillery.
The highlight of the excursion is a falconry display at Dunrobin Castle, where guests can witness the majestic birds in action.
